湖北大学知行学院《数据库原理及应用》2022-2023学年第一学期期末试卷_第1页
湖北大学知行学院《数据库原理及应用》2022-2023学年第一学期期末试卷_第2页
湖北大学知行学院《数据库原理及应用》2022-2023学年第一学期期末试卷_第3页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

站名:站名:年级专业:姓名:学号:凡年级专业、姓名、学号错写、漏写或字迹不清者,成绩按零分记。…………密………………封………………线…………第1页,共1页湖北大学知行学院《数据库原理及应用》

2022-2023学年第一学期期末试卷题号一二三四总分得分一、单选题(本大题共15个小题,每小题1分,共15分.在每小题给出的四个选项中,只有一项是符合题目要求的.)1、在数据库的事务隔离级别中,不同的级别对并发事务的可见性和一致性有不同的影响。假设一个在线购物数据库系统,有商品库存表。以下关于事务隔离级别的描述,哪一项是不正确的?()A.读未提交(ReadUncommitted)隔离级别允许一个事务读取另一个未提交事务修改的数据,可能导致脏读B.读已提交(ReadCommitted)隔离级别只能读取已提交事务的数据,避免了脏读,但可能导致不可重复读C.可重复读(RepeatableRead)隔离级别保证在同一个事务中多次读取的数据是一致的,避免了不可重复读和幻读D.串行化(Serializable)隔离级别通过串行执行事务,保证了最高的隔离性,但并发度最低2、在数据库的优化过程中,对数据库架构进行调整是一种常见的方法。以下关于数据库架构调整的描述,哪一项是不正确的?()A.可以根据业务需求对表结构进行重构B.增加冗余字段可以提高查询性能,但会增加数据维护的复杂性C.分表和分区可以解决数据量过大的问题D.数据库架构调整一定能显著提高系统性能,且不会带来任何风险3、假设要对数据库中的数据进行加密存储,同时不影响查询性能。以下哪种加密方式可能是最合适的?()A.对称加密,加密和解密使用相同的密钥B.非对称加密,使用公钥加密,私钥解密C.字段级加密,对特定字段进行加密D.数据库自带的加密功能4、数据库的安全性是至关重要的。以下关于数据库安全性措施的描述,哪一项是不准确的?()A.用户认证和授权可以控制对数据库的访问B.加密可以保护数据的机密性C.定期审计可以发现潜在的安全威胁D.只要设置了强密码,数据库就绝对安全5、假设正在进行数据库的优化工作,发现某个查询语句执行时间过长。通过分析执行计划,发现存在大量的全表扫描操作。以下哪种方法可能有助于减少全表扫描?()A.增加索引B.优化查询语句的写法C.对表进行分区D.以上方法都可能有效6、假设要对数据库中的数据进行定期的清理和归档,以下哪种策略可能是最合理的?()A.根据时间戳或业务规则删除过期数据B.将不常用的数据移动到归档表或数据库C.对数据进行压缩存储,而不是直接删除或移动D.以上都是7、假设要对一个包含大量销售数据的数据库进行数据分析,以找出最畅销的产品和销售趋势。以下哪种数据库操作和技术可能是最关键的?()A.使用索引来加速数据的查询和检索B.执行复杂的连接(JOIN)操作来整合不同表中的数据C.运用聚合函数(如SUM、COUNT、AVG等)进行数据统计和分析D.创建视图(VIEW)来简化复杂的查询8、数据库的存储管理涉及到数据在磁盘上的存储方式和组织。以下关于数据库存储管理的描述,错误的是:()A.数据库中的数据通常以文件的形式存储在磁盘上,文件可以分为数据文件和日志文件等B.磁盘块是磁盘存储的基本单位,数据库系统通过对磁盘块的管理来提高数据的读写效率C.数据库系统可以采用顺序存储、索引存储和哈希存储等多种存储方式D.存储管理只需要考虑数据的存储效率,不需要考虑数据的安全性和完整性9、数据库的性能监控和调优是持续的工作。假设一个在线游戏的数据库在高峰时段出现性能瓶颈,以下哪种监控指标能够最直接地反映出问题所在?()A.CPU利用率B.内存使用情况C.等待事件D.磁盘I/O操作10、数据库的并发控制是为了处理多个事务同时执行时可能出现的问题。以下关于并发控制机制的描述,哪一项是不正确的?()A.封锁机制可以保证事务的隔离性B.乐观并发控制假设冲突很少发生C.悲观并发控制会降低并发度D.并发控制机制对数据库的性能没有任何影响11、在一个数据库应用中,需要对大量的数据进行排序操作。为了提高排序性能,可以考虑以下哪些因素?()A.增加内存,以便能够容纳更多的排序数据B.选择合适的排序算法,如快速排序或归并排序C.优化索引结构,减少排序过程中的数据读取D.以上因素都需要考虑12、假设正在设计一个数据库来存储电商网站的用户购物车信息,包括用户ID、商品ID、商品数量、添加时间等字段。由于购物车信息的更新频繁,以下哪种数据结构或存储方式可能更适合?()A.关系型数据库表B.缓存(如Redis)C.文件存储D.分布式数据库13、在数据库的并发控制中,假设有两个事务同时对同一数据进行操作,可能会导致数据不一致的情况。以下哪种并发控制机制可以避免这种问题?()A.悲观并发控制B.乐观并发控制C.共享锁和排他锁D.以上都是14、假设一个数据库系统需要与外部系统进行数据集成,以下哪种接口或协议可能是最常用的?()A.ODBC(开放数据库连接)B.JDBC(Java数据库连接)C.RESTfulAPID.以上都是15、数据库的完整性约束用于确保数据的准确性和一致性。以下关于完整性约束的描述,哪一项是不正确的?()A.主键约束保证了表中每行数据的唯一性B.外键约束用于维护表之间的关系C.检查约束可以限制列中的值范围D.完整性约束会降低数据插入和更新的效率,应尽量少用二、简答题(本大题共4个小题,共20分)1、(本题5分)解释数据库中的存储过程参数数据类型。2、(本题5分)解释数据库中的存储过程递归调用。3、(本题5分)解释数据库中的聚集函数(如SUM、AVG、COUNT等)。4、(本题5分)简述数据库中的数据库链接。三、综合应用题(本大题共5个小题,共25分)1、(本题5分)为一个游泳馆课程管理系统设计数据库,涵盖课程类型、学员、教练等表,完成查询某位教练的课程学员名单。2、(本题5分)为一个图书馆采购管理系统创建数据库,包括采购订单、图书、供应商等表,实现查询某个供应商的采购订单。3、(本题5分)为一个共享单车数据库,包含单车、用户和骑行记录。进行如下查询:-查找某位用户的所有骑行记录。-计算每辆单车的日均使用时长。-找出日均使用时长最长的单车编号和用户姓名。4、(本题5分)设计一个加油站管理系统的数据库,有油品、加油记录、客户等表,完成查询某个客户的加油消费记录。5、(本题5分)设计一个学校教师教学评价管理系统的数据库,涵盖教师、评价指标、评价结果等表,完成查询某位教师的评价结果。四、设计题(本大题共4个小题,共40分)1、(本题10分)为一个电影票务系统设计数据库,存储电影的信息(电影名称、导演、主演、上映时间、票价等)、影院的信息(影院名称、地址、座位数量等)以及用户的购票记录(用户姓名、购买场次、座位号等)。设计合理的表结构,支持高并发的购票操作和数据查询。2、(本题10分)构建一个电商售后服务系统的数据库,系统记录商品的售后申请、处理进度和客户反馈。商品有商品信息和销售记录。售后人员有工作记录和处理结果。客户有售后评价和投诉记录。请设计完整的数据库表,明确表之间的关系,并探讨如何实现售后服务质量提升和客户满意度调查。3、(本题10分)为一个在线游戏平台设计数据库,存储游戏的信息(游戏名称、类型、开发商、在线人数等)、玩家的信息(用户名、密码、游戏角色等)以及玩家的游戏成绩和充值记录。设计合理的表结构,满足游戏平

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论